Xinhua News Agency, Beijing, February 20th. On February 20th, Foreign Minister Qin Gang had a telephone conversation with British Minister of Foreign Affairs and Development Cleverley.

  Qin Gang said that both China and the UK are permanent members of the UN Security Council and are important countries in the world. A sound Sino-British relationship not only serves the interests of the two countries, but also contributes to world peace and development.

China is not a challenge or threat to the UK.

China is committed to high-quality development and high-level opening up. The super-large-scale market advantages and domestic demand potential will continue to be released. The two countries can achieve complementary advantages and mutually beneficial cooperation.

Harmony makes money, and the cooperation between the two sides is inseparable from the good atmosphere between the two countries.

It is hoped that the UK side will view China's development objectively and rationally, meet China halfway, enhance mutual trust, properly handle differences, establish correct understanding of each other, strengthen cooperation, and promote the healthy and stable development of bilateral relations.

  Cleverly said that China has made great development achievements in the past few decades, and hundreds of millions of people have been lifted out of poverty, becoming an important force in the world economy.

The UK is willing to strengthen high-level exchanges and strategic communication with China, deepen exchanges and cooperation in various fields, and jointly address global challenges such as climate change and food security.

  The two sides also exchanged views on issues of common concern.
